Akshay Kumar and Twinkle Khanna's sea-facing Juhu home worth Rs 80 crore: 'From being stopped at gate to owning the bungalow'

Akshay Kumar and Twinkle Khanna’s Juhu home is a luxurious yet warm seaside paradise. The house boasts a stone sculpture at the entrance, festive decorations, and a tropical garden lounge with vibrant flowers and cozy seating. An outdoor nook offers a peaceful retreat, while the living room features soft tones, elegant chandeliers, and a swing-style lounger.

Akshay Kumar once shared a story about his home in a video that’s been featured on a real estate website. He revealed that 32 years ago, he was turned away from this very spot, and now, years later, he owns the same property. His sea-facing Juhu home with Twinkle Khanna is everything you imagine a dream house should be. The moment you walk in, there’s this stone sculpture that stops you in your tracks. Marigold garlands, fairy lights—festive vibes all around. Add some wooden fencing and greenery, and it somehow manages to feel fancy without being stiff. Their garden lounge is a total vibe. Bright magenta and purple flowers pop everywhere, and there’s this L-shaped cushioned bench. The wooden fence, blue-grey tiles, and palm trees? Instant tropical getaway—right in Mumbai.And wait, there’s more. Around the corner, there’s a little outdoor nook that’s perfect for literally anything: reading a book, working on a laptop, or just staring at the greenery and pretending your life is a movie. There’s a wooden table with six foldable chairs under a tree, facing this rustic blue gate, and it just feels… homey. Their garden is massive and lush. And the glass doors? They open straight into the garden so the indoors and outdoors basically merge. Inside, the living room is calm, classy, and cozy all at once. Soft neutral tones with a hint of gold, round chandeliers, textured walls, a chic rug, a stylish side table, comfy seating—it all works without looking overdone. The blue sofa and round dining table? Perfect touch. Elegant but not intimidating. And then… the swing-style hanging lounger. Yes, they actually have one. Woven ropes, soft cushions, hanging from the ceiling—total cozy-meets-cool vibes. Behind it, there’s a giant custom bookshelf stacked with books and even a typewriter. Yep, this is probably where Twinkle sits and writes her next big thing.Honestly, every corner of this house has personality. It’s not just a fancy bungalow—it’s a home.
